It > > > sounds to me like DCC should be off in SA by default going > > > forward, or possibly completely removed from SA future > > > versions so users don't accidentally get in a license/legal > > > dispute without their knowledge. > > > 1. DCC was already made into a plugin for 3.1. > 2. The DCC plugin was disabled by default for 3.1. > 3. DCC is still usable by most people and can be enabled for access by > the SpamAssassin code relatively easily. > 4. The end user/administrator needs to determine whether or > not they can install/use the DCC client per the license for DCC. > > In short, users are responsible for making sure that they can > use the software they're installing.
